In memory of Annie Rene Damm.
This is a commemorative resolution (SR 698), not a policy bill. It formally honors Annie Rene Damm, a Texan who died on February 4, 2025, at age 85, by memorializing her life and extending condolences to her family. The resolution specifically acknowledges her family connections, faith, and dedication to loved ones, including her children, gr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and siblings. It has no policy impact - only symbolic meaning, as the Texas Senate resolves to pay tribute to her memory and adjourn in her honor.
